UK: ASUS ROG Strix Scar G733QR by errorusernameinuse in GamingLaptops

[–]errorusernameinuse[S] 6 points7 points  (0 children)

Just arrived and im going through setting up.

Its a 17" 300hz FHD screen, with a Ryzen 7 5800H, 3070 8GB GPU, 16GB DDR4 3200 RAM, 1TB SSD NVME... has the mechanical keyboard and the other bits of fluff you get with a Scar. The biggest plus point is that it comes with a 2 year warranty, so an extra years cover which is a nice to have.

Cant comment on performance as im literally setting up... im even typing this post on my current MSI GT62VR 7RE :D

Cost, well the UK we seem to get boned, so £1899 for this unit. Looking forward to digging in and tbh just want to get Valheim installed asap.. push that GPU ;)
